All installed elements
PLL synchronization method (when the PLL source is not set to Smp Clk) or external sampling
clock method (when the PLL source is set to Smp Clk)
• PLL synchronization method
Fundamental frequency of the PLL source is in the range of 10 Hz to 2.6 kHz.
• External sampling clock method
Input a sampling clock signal having a frequency that is 3000 times the fundamental frequency
between 0.1 Hz and 66 Hz of the waveform on which to perform harmonic measurement. The
input level is TTL. The input waveform is a rectangular wave with a duty ratio of 50%.
• Select the voltage or current of each input element (external current sensor range is greater than
or equal to 500 mV) or the external clock (Ext Clk or Smp Clk).
• Input level
Greater than or equal to 50% of the measurement range rating when the crest factor is 3
Greater than or equal to 100% of the measurement range rating when the crest factor is 6
• Turn the frequency filter ON when the fundamental frequency is less than or equal to 440 Hz.
See section 7.11.
9000
32 bits
Rectangular
Set using a line filter (OFF, 500 Hz, 5.5 kHz, or 50 kHz).
